As part of Coline Perdrier’s thesis, the first scientific article from the LOOP4PACK project has been published in Process Biochemistry! It is entitled “Impact of overflow vs. limitation of propionic acid on poly(3-hydroxybutyrate-co-3-hydroxyvalerate) biosynthesis”.

This article investigated the impact of carbon-limiting vs. carbon-overflow conditions thanks to fed-batch cultures, with continuous or sequential feeding of propionic acid as the sole carbon source, and phosphorus deficiency conditions. In this line, the copolymer molecular structure (i.e. 3-hydroxyvalerate (3HV) content, molecular weight, polydispersity index and monomeric distribution) with regard to biosynthesis performances (i.e. productivity and conversion yield of substrate into copolymer) were assessed depending on the implemented feeding strategy.
